Tadola Population - Raigarh, Chhattisgarh
Tadola is a medium size village located in Pusour Tehsil of Raigarh district, Chhattisgarh with total 454 families residing. The Tadola village has population of 1756 of which 866 are males while 890 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Tadola village population of children with age 0-6 is 212 which makes up 12.07 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Tadola village is 1028 which is higher than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Tadola as per census is 893,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Tadola village has higher liter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Tadola village was 76.94 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Tadola Male literacy stands at 90.05 % while female literacy rate was 64.43 %.

Tadola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 454 | - | - |
Population | 1,756 | 866 | 890 |
Child (0-6) | 212 | 112 | 100 |
Schedule Caste | 138 | 63 | 75 |
Schedule Tribe | 896 | 428 | 468 |
Literacy | 76.94 % | 90.05 % | 64.43 % |
Total Workers | 825 | 498 | 327 |
Main Worker | 555 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 270 | 98 | 172 |
